Whatever reason brought you here, I hope you stay. I started One Eighty Counseling because I yearned to create a counseling practice that focused on open, kind communication and acceptance. I wanted my own corner of the world where people could truly come as they are. This means that my clients, their families, and their stories could be acknowledged without judgement or fear, and most importantly without rejection. In my practice, I work best with individuals who are looking for a long-term therapeutic relationship to work on struggles over time. I work through a person-centered lens where I believe you are the expert on you.
Some fun, yet still professional tidbits about me: I am a snacker by nature. I'd rather have snacks over a meal any day. I love to dance to any music and TikTok is my jam. My favorite color switches between rainbow and glitter (yes, both are a color- we don't discriminate around here!). I can do the laundry all day long, but unload the dishwasher? No way.
Ultimately, I believe that each individual is worthy of love, acceptance, and kindness, no matter their story. It is my job to create a safe space to process, support, and explore with you.
